- Take a lead role in engagement management through internal
communication and tracking engagement status
- Review engagement letters prepared by Associates
- Review confirmations (includes debt, syndicators, etc.)
- Communicate directly with clients regarding request lists and
confirmations
- Review or perform compliance testing for more difficult audits
(HUD, RD, NFP)
- Prepare files for audit (Bring in TBs, GLs, bank statements, &
other supporting documents)
- Prepare 10%, contractor and owner certifications, and DCRs
- Review financial statement changes and draft and AJEs, RJEs,
ATBs
- Review or prepare final financial statements and lockdown
files
- Actively participate in firm initiatives
- Act as a role model and mentor to Associates and internsBasic
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ting or equivalent field
- 2+ years of progressive audit and/or assurance
experiencePreferred/Desired Qualifications:
- Master's degree in Accounting or equivalent field
